UNUSUAL PHASES TO THREE-HORSE RACE ALTHOUGH there was a .lake of £300 for the Banyule Hurdles at Moonee Valley (Melbourne) recently, only three horses competed. It was a thrilling race, however, and the three runners were almost in line at the last hurdle. The race went to the odds-on favourite Giant Killer. The event was started at 1.59 p.m. It was timed to start at 2 p.m., and this is the first occasion veteran racegoers can recall a race being run even a minute earlier than the advertised time. The other two runners were Terka and Triteleia, but despite the small field, Terka ran into trouble and appeared to get on Tritelei&'s heels at the home turn.
